the exterior angle of a triangle is 105° and the interior opposite angle are same. find each of the equal angle.

Exterior angle is equal to the sum of the opposite interior angles.

Exterior angle = 105 (Given)

Both interior angles are the same (Given)

.............................................................................................

Find one angle:

Since both angles are the same, we will divide their sum by 2:

one angle = 105 ÷ 2 = 52.5°

.............................................................................................

Answer: One angle is 52.5°
